What defines classical bronze statues?
Bronze has been one of the most durable materials for sculpture for millennia. Its high copper content provides robustness, crisp detail and a noble patina that makes each piece unique. Classical bronze statues focus on a harmonious, balanced visual language – inspired by antiquity, the Renaissance and other periods that still set the standard for proportion, expression and craftsmanship today. As a result, these works fit confidently into both classic and modern interiors and, thanks to their weather-resistant surface, are excellently suited for outdoor use. Our figures are created using the lost-wax casting process. First, the model is built up in wax and provided with sprues. A heat-resistant mould is then fired, the wax melted out and the bronze poured in molten. After cooling, numerous steps follow such as demoulding, fine welding, grinding and chasing. Finally, the surface is patinated and protected with wax. This process enables the finest details, crisp contours and a surface quality you can see and feel – true craftsmanship that lasts for generations. How can you recognize a genuine bronze figure?
Genuine bronze feels cool and heavy, is not magnetic and shows fine traces of hand finishing (e.g. chasing). The patina is not a simple paint layer but chemically produced. Both sound and material feel full and dense. At Eliassen you also receive a certificate as proof of authenticity.
